You can create sub-accounts within (under) your account, or within any other sub-accounts within your account.
Sub-accounts are useful if you manage events for client organizations, or if you manage events for other divisions of your company. Sub-accounts keep event and registration data separate from other accounts.

Account Settings
This section is displayed when you add a new sub-account or edit an existing one.Account Code
Account Code is used to uniquely identify each account. The Account Code is also the name of the directory used to store static files for that account. The static files include images, Excel spreadsheets, and PDF attachments.The Account Code is used in the profile Username calculation. This calculation applies if you use system-generated Username values.
Account Code must consist of only numbers and letters.
> Caution: Account Code must be unique regardless of case. For example, the code “MySubAccount” cannot match an existing sub-account Unique Code “mysubaccount”.
Since the system requires a unique code, you may need to try several values before the system accepts the code.
> Best Practice: Use the shortest code possible that uniquely identifies the account.
Support Rep
Support Rep is the user within your account who will provide front-line customer support for the client account.Parent Account
Parent Account is the account directly above the client account. In large organizations, the relationship between the account owner and the client account may go several levels deep.Customer ID Number
Customer ID Number is selected from two options.- Use parent account value is the default selection. Use parent account value unless you negotiated a separate billing agreement for the sub-account you are creating.
- Enter new customer ID should be selected only if you negotiated a separate billing agreement for the sub-account you are creating. Enter the Customer ID value provided by Certain in the field added here when this option is selected.
Active
Active is a check box that controls user access to the sub-account. When you create a sub-account, the Active check box is left clear by default. Select Active to enable users to access the account.Copy Custom Account Data
Copy Custom Account Data lets you copy Custom Account Data to the sub-account you are adding or editing.Custom Account Data includes Content Blocks and Custom Profile, Custom Event, and Custom Display Fields. The page links are:
Copy Custom Account Data can speed up and simplify the process of adding a sub-account when you create many sub-accounts.
The accounts you can select are:
- the current account
- sibling accounts (other sub-accounts sharing the same Parent Account)
- the sub-accounts of the current account
Account Information
Account Information is contact information for the sub-account’s primary contact.
Certain invoices will be sent to this contact.
